This spring and summer, heads will roll. That’s because indie darlings the Yeah Yeah Yeahs just announced an 18-date tour across North America, Europe and even a stop in Japan, in support of their 2022 album Cool It Down. The tour will launch on May 3rd in Washington, DC and wrap August 29th in Berlin, Germany, and be supported by The Faint and Perfume Genius, with whom they collaborated on “Spitting Off the Edge of the World.” Along the way, they’ll make stops at several festivals, including here in Los Angeles at the Just Like Heaven Festival in Pasadena on May 13th — see below for all dates. What have the Yeah Yeah Yeahs been up to?

The Yeah Yeah Yeahs were active from 2000 to 2014, and reunited in 2017. They were nominated for two Grammy’s at this past Sunday’s awards, for Best Alternative Music Album in Cool It Down, and Best Alternative Music Performance in “Spitting Off the Edge of the World.” They lost both to Wet Leg.
